NASA Ground Control Software Flaw Enables Unauthenticated Commands
Critical flaws in NASA's AIT-GUI ground control software let unauthenticated attackers send spacecraft commands and execute scripts.

Anyone able to reach the ground control interface could send unauthorized commands without valid credentials. The report does not indicate that the flaws have been exploited in the wild.
